National AI Awards 2025Discover AI's trailblazers! Join us to celebrate innovation and nominate industry leaders.

Nominate & Attend

Machine Learning Engineer (W/M/D)

Ultralytics
London
2 days ago
Create job alert

Get AI-powered advice on this job and more exclusive features. Founder & CEO at Ultralytics | Democratizing vision AI At Ultralytics, we relentlessly drive innovation in AI, building the world's leading open-source models. We're looking for passionate individuals obsessed with AI, eager to make a global impact, and ready to excel in a dynamic, high-energy environment. Join our team and help shape the future of Vision AI. This full-time Machine Learning Engineer position is based onsite in our brand-new Ultralytics office in London, UK. Applicants must have legal authorization to work in the UK, as Ultralytics does not provide visa sponsorship. As a Machine Learning Engineer at Ultralytics, you will be at the forefront of developing and refining our world-class Ultralytics YOLO models. You will work on the entire lifecycle of our models, from research and development to high-performance deployment. Developing, training, and validating state-of-the-art models for a variety of computer vision tasks, including detection, segmentation, and classification. Writing highly efficient, scalable, and production-ready code in Python using the PyTorch framework. Optimizing models for high-performance inference on diverse hardware using tools like NVIDIA TensorRT, OpenVINO, and ONNX. Managing and processing large-scale datasets and implementing advanced data augmentation strategies. Designing and maintaining robust CI/CD pipelines with GitHub Actions for automated model training, testing, and benchmarking. Engaging with our global community by creating documentation, tutorials, and supporting users to solve real-world problems with our technology. Your expertise will be critical in advancing the capabilities of our models and supporting Ultralytics' mission to make AI easy and accessible for everyone. ️ 5+ years of professional experience in Machine Learning Engineering or a similar role. ~ Deep expertise in Python and deep learning frameworks, with a strong preference for PyTorch. ~ Proven experience with computer vision and a strong understanding of model architectures like transformers and CNNs. ~ Hands-on experience with model optimization (i.E. quantization, pruning) and model deployment frameworks such as TensorRT, ONNX Runtime, and OpenVINO. ~ Proficiency with CUDA programming and optimizing code for GPU acceleration. ~ Experience contributing to major open-source projects is a significant advantage. Ultralytics is a high-performance environment for world-class talent obsessed with achieving extraordinary results. If your priority is predictable comfort or a standard work-life balance over the relentless pursuit of progress, Ultralytics is not for you. We seek driven individuals prepared for the profound personal investment required to make a defining contribution to the future of AI. Compensation and Benefits Competitive Salary: Highly competitive based on experience. Hybrid Flexibility: 3 days per week in our brand-new office - 2 days remote. Generous Time Off: 24 days vacation, your birthday off, plus local holidays. Flexible Hours: Tailor your working hours to suit your productivity. Tech: Engage with cutting-edge AI projects. Gear: Brand-new Apple MacBook and Apple Display provided. If you are driven to redefine the capabilities of machine learning and eager to make a significant impact, Ultralytics offers an exceptional career opportunity. Employment type Full-time Industries Software Development and Information Services Sign in to set job alerts for “Machine Learning Engineer” roles. Data Scientist - AI / ML, Python, Scripting, Cyber Security Graduate Software Engineer – ML Data Platform We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I. #

Related Jobs

View all jobs

Machine Learning Engineer

Machine Learning Engineer

Machine Learning Engineer

Machine Learning Engineer

Machine Learning/AI Engineer

Machine Learning Engineer

National AI Awards 2025

Subscribe to Future Tech Insights for the latest jobs & insights, direct to your inbox.

By subscribing, you agree to our privacy policy and terms of service.

Industry Insights

Discover insightful articles, industry insights, expert tips, and curated resources.

AI Jobs Skills Radar 2026: Emerging Frameworks, Languages & Tools to Learn Now

As the UK’s AI sector accelerates towards a £1 trillion tech economy, the job landscape is rapidly evolving. Whether you’re an aspiring AI engineer, a machine learning specialist, or a data-driven software developer, staying ahead of the curve means more than just brushing up on Python. You’ll need to master a new generation of frameworks, languages, and tools shaping the future of artificial intelligence. Welcome to the AI Jobs Skills Radar 2026—your definitive guide to the emerging AI tech stack that employers will be looking for in the next 12–24 months. Updated annually for accuracy and relevance, this guide breaks down the top tools, frameworks, platforms, and programming languages powering the UK’s most in-demand AI careers.

How to Find Hidden AI Jobs in the UK Using Professional Bodies like BCS, IET & the Turing Society

When it comes to job hunting in artificial intelligence (AI), most candidates head straight to traditional job boards, LinkedIn, or recruitment agencies. But what if there was a better way to find roles that aren’t advertised publicly? What if you could access hidden job leads, gain inside knowledge, or get referred by people already in the field? That’s where professional bodies and specialist AI communities come in. In this article, we’ll explore how UK-based organisations like BCS (The Chartered Institute for IT), IET (The Institution of Engineering and Technology), and the Turing Society can help you uncover AI job opportunities you won’t find elsewhere. We'll show you how to strategically use their directories, special-interest groups (SIGs), and CPD (Continuing Professional Development) events to elevate your career and expand your AI job search in ways most job seekers overlook.

How to Get a Better AI Job After a Lay-Off or Redundancy

Being made redundant or laid off can feel like the rug has been pulled from under you. Whether part of a wider company restructuring, budget cuts, or market shifts in tech, many skilled professionals in the AI industry have recently found themselves unexpectedly jobless. But while redundancy brings immediate financial and emotional stress, it can also be a powerful catalyst for career growth. In the fast-evolving field of artificial intelligence, where new roles and specialisms emerge constantly, bouncing back stronger is not only possible—it’s likely. In this guide, we’ll walk you through a step-by-step action plan for turning redundancy into your next big opportunity. From managing the shock to targeting better AI jobs, updating your CV, and approaching recruiters the smart way, we’ll help you move from setback to comeback.